Summary

Donald Trump appointed 22-year-old Thomas Fugate to lead the DHS Center for Prevention Programs and Partnerships (CP3), which combats terrorism and hate violence.

Fugate, who graduated in 2024, previously worked as a grocery store clerk and self-employed landscaper.

He joined Trump’s 2024 campaign and briefly served as a special assistant in DHS immigration.

Despite lacking direct experience in counterterrorism, DHS officials cited his work ethic in justifying his rapid promotion. His political rise includes internships with the Heritage Foundation and Texas lawmakers, and an active pro-Trump social media presence.
